Build Shopify App: llms.txt Generator + JSON-LD Schema + FAQ Generator + AI Feed

Hi – Itโ€™s a smart concept – giving merchants an โ€œAI readiness toolkitโ€ for their stores and I can build a production-quality MVP that passes Shopify App Store review and earns great merchant feedback. ๐‘๐ž๐š๐ฅ๐ฅ๐ฒ ๐ž๐ฑ๐œ๐ข๐ญ๐ž๐ ๐ญ๐จ ๐›๐ซ๐ข๐ง๐  ๐ญ๐ก๐ข๐ฌ ๐’๐ก๐จ๐ฉ๐ข๐Ÿ๐ฒ ๐š๐ฉ๐ฉ ๐ฏ๐ข๐ฌ๐ข๐จ๐ง ๐ญ๐จ ๐ฅ๐ข๐Ÿ๐ž.

Iโ€™ve built and launched Shopify apps before , so I understand the full lifecycle โ†’ from planning, building and testing, to handling the App Store submission.

๐Ÿงฉ ๐Œ๐ฒ ๐๐ซ๐ž๐ฏ๐ข๐จ๐ฎ๐ฌ ๐’๐ก๐จ๐ฉ๐ข๐Ÿ๐ฒ ๐€๐ฉ๐ฉ๐ฌ (๐‹๐ข๐ฏ๐ž)

1) Order Invoice Printing App
A robust order documentation solution:

Print invoices, packing slips, return slips, and refund slips directly from the Shopify dashboard.
Advanced template customization using HTML/CSS for full branding control.
Automated PDF delivery via email with secure download links.
Bilingual support and flexible text/image integration.

This app helped merchants save hours every week on operational paperwork while improving the customer experience.

2) Shopify Page Lock App
Secure access control for selected pages:

Lock any Shopify page behind password protection (great for wholesale/VIP collections).
Works with all themes without code edits.
Fully customizable password page design to match the brand.

This app gave merchants the ability to control who sees what, without disrupting their storefront layout or theme code.

(๐ˆ ๐ก๐š๐ฏ๐ž ๐š๐ญ๐ญ๐š๐œ๐ก๐ž๐ ๐ญ๐ก๐ž ๐š๐ฉ๐ฉ ๐ฏ๐ข๐๐ž๐จ๐ฌ, ๐๐ฅ๐ž๐š๐ฌ๐ž ๐ก๐š๐ฏ๐ž ๐š ๐ฅ๐จ๐จ๐ค.)

โ†’โ†’ How Iโ€™ll Handle llms.txt Hosting- Iโ€™ll use a Shopify App Proxy to serve the llms.txt file at /apps/oxbow/llms.txt. Then Iโ€™ll set up a redirect from /llms.txt on the merchantโ€™s store to the App Proxy endpoint (via a small theme snippet).

Why App Proxy:

It serves the file from the merchantโ€™s own domain, which is better for AI crawlers and SEO.
It avoids CORS issues and is allowed by Shopify App Store policies.
It lets us apply caching headers (ETag, Last-Modified) for fast performance.

โ†’โ†’ What Iโ€™ll Deliver

llms.txt Generator (daily + manual regenerate, admin preview)
JSON-LD schema injector for Products, Blogs, FAQs (safe embed/snippet approach)
GPT-powered FAQ generator + editor + publish options (with FAQPage schema)
AI syndication feed (/apps/oxbow/ai-feed.json) with correct headers & caching
โ€œCheck My AI Visibilityโ€ lead capture button inside admin
Admin UI with clean Polaris design
Deployment pipeline + documentation
App Store submission (listing copy, screenshots, setup guide)

๐“๐ž๐œ๐ก ๐’๐ญ๐š๐œ๐ค: ๐๐จ๐๐ž.๐ฃ๐ฌ (๐Š๐จ๐š/๐„๐ฑ๐ฉ๐ซ๐ž๐ฌ๐ฌ) + ๐‘๐ž๐š๐œ๐ญ (๐๐จ๐ฅ๐š๐ซ๐ข๐ฌ) + ๐’๐ก๐จ๐ฉ๐ข๐Ÿ๐ฒ ๐€๐ฉ๐ฉ ๐๐ซ๐ข๐๐ ๐ž & ๐Ž๐€๐ฎ๐ญ๐ก + ๐๐จ๐ฌ๐ญ๐ ๐ซ๐ž๐’๐๐‹ (๐จ๐ซ ๐Œ๐จ๐ง๐ ๐จ๐ƒ๐) ๐๐ž๐ฉ๐ฅ๐จ๐ฒ๐ž๐ ๐จ๐ง ๐‘๐ž๐ง๐๐ž๐ซ/๐•๐ž๐ซ๐œ๐ž๐ฅ/๐‡๐ž๐ซ๐จ๐ค๐ฎ.

๐„๐ฌ๐ญ๐ข๐ฆ๐š๐ญ๐ž๐ ๐“๐ข๐ฆ๐ž๐ฅ๐ข๐ง๐ž- ๐Ÿ-๐Ÿ‘ ๐ฆ๐จ๐ง๐ญ๐ก๐ฌ

โœ… Confirmation you can handle App Store submission end-to-end.

โ† Iโ€™ve built and launched Shopify apps before .
โ† I can handle the App Proxy setup and public endpoints
โ† I can deliver a production-ready app that meets Shopifyโ€™s App Store requirements
โ† I will handle the entire App Store submission – listing copy, screenshots, privacy/data docs, and reviewer Q&A.

If this plan sounds good, I can prepare a short technical architecture draft and start with the llms.txt + AI feed modules as the first milestone.

Letโ€™s make merchants discoverable by AI- and get this app earning 5-star reviews in the Shopify App Store.

Looking forward to hearing from you,
๐€๐š๐ง๐œ๐ก๐š๐ฅ ๐’.
๐’๐ก๐จ๐ฉ๐ข๐Ÿ๐ฒ ๐€๐ฉ๐ฉ ๐ƒ๐ž๐ฏ๐ž๐ฅ๐จ๐ฉ๐ฆ๐ž๐ง๐ญ ๐Œ๐š๐ฌ๐ญ๐ž๐ซ

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*